1915 Key Retirees - Pitchers


Jim Buchanan, Orioles

Buchanan had six successful years as Baltimore's closer. That was good enough to get him the 6th most saves all-time.





Andy Coakley, Athletics

Coakley was one of Oakland's starting pitchers in the early days of the league prior to the team getting most of the superstar batters that they have today. He started three World Series games, winning one in 1904 and one in 1907. He pitched in eight World Series games as a reliever across five World Series from 1908-13.




Dummy Taylor, Giants

Taylor was a constant in San Francisco's starting rotation for 12 years, most of those years being on poor teams.
